Suggest Remedy For Rash On Body With Extreme Dry Skin And Oval Spots After Taking Shots On Back For Pain

I have a rash on most of my body very dry skin and spots that are ovel in shape and blood red I have been on pain meds and nesaids for almost two years I frist noticed this rash a few months ago after they gave me some shots in my back to block the pain I ended up having surgery the rash and dry skin and itching are only getting worse

Hi, Welcome to Health care magic forum.
As you describe it appears to be an allergic reaction, to some of the pain killers you have used. Try to note down the tablets you have used since the time before the begening of the rash,and the injection given to you.
Avoid the drugs you are using one by one and observe the position of the rash.
I advise you to consult a dermatologist for diagnosis and treatment.
